What is the lifespan of a PS4 controller?

By the way, the PS4 controller lifespan can be 3-7 years depending on how often you use it. After several years, its battery life might start to decline. If you expect to extend the PS4 controller lifespan, you should not use fast-charging cords.

How many hours can a PS4 controller last?

Typically, the DualShock 4 lasts for four to eight hours of play per charge (typically on the lower end of that range), far less than the Xbox One controller or the Nintendo Switch Pro controller.

How do I know if my PS4 controller is dying?

It sounds simple, but if the battery in your controller is almost dead, it may disconnect. To check your controller battery life, hold the PS Button to bring up the Quick Menu on the left side of the screen. You'll see a controller icon with battery life displayed at the bottom.

How do I fix my unresponsive PS4 controller?

Use a small, unfolded paper clip (or something similar) to press and hold the reset button for at least five seconds. Your controller should now have been reset. Connect your controller to the PS4 console using the official USB cable. Connect to a USB port on the front (or rear) of the PS4 console.

Do PS5 controllers last longer than PS4?

The DualShock 4 typically lasts for four to eight hours of play per charge, often falling on the lower end of that range. The PS5 DualSense battery life is slightly better, averaging between six to 12 hours depending on the game you're playing, but often averaging around six to eight hours.

Do PS4 controllers have replaceable batteries?

Unfortunately, The DualShock 4 battery is internal and not intended for personal replacement or removal. Other than disassembling the controller and replacing the battery internally (voiding your warranty) there is no method for replacing the battery.
